Python支持成员运算符,测试实例中包含了一系列的成员,包括字符串,列表或元组。
运算符描述实例in如果在指定的序列中找到值返回 True,否则返回 False。x 在 y 序列中 , 如果 x 在 y 序列中返回 True。not in如果在指定的序列中没有找到值返回 True,否则返回 False。x 不在 y 序列中 , 如果 x 不在 y 序列中返回 True。
例子
1、成员运算符:in/not in
当names列表中包含小写的Kety,就输出存在,否则不存在
names = ['Job','Bili','Laoyew','kety'] name = 'Kety' if name.lower() in names: print('存在') else: print('不存在')
当names列表中不包含大写的Kety,就输出不存在,否则存在
if name.upper() not in names: print('不存在') else: print('存在')
以上就是python if在成员运算符中的使用。更多Python学习推荐:PyThon学习网教学中心。